1. High Magnetic Strength in a Compact Size

One of the most significant advantages of using cylindrical magnets in electronic devices is their ability to pack a powerful magnetic field into a small space. Cylindrical magnets, especially those made from high - performance materials like neodymium, can generate a strong magnetic force relative to their size. This is crucial in modern electronics, where miniaturization is the name of the game.

For example, in smartphones, space is extremely limited. Cylindrical magnets can be used in the camera autofocus system. Their strong magnetic field allows for precise and rapid movement of the lens elements, enabling quick and sharp focusing. 2. Design Flexibility

Cylindrical magnets offer great design flexibility. Their simple and regular shape makes them easy to integrate into various electronic device designs. They can be easily inserted into holes, slots, or other custom - made compartments within the device.

This flexibility is especially useful in the development of new and innovative electronic products. For instance, in wearable devices, the design needs to be both functional and aesthetically pleasing. Cylindrical magnets can be arranged in different configurations to fit the unique shape and size requirements of the wearable. They can be used in magnetic clasps for smartwatches or in the sensors of fitness trackers. 3. Consistent Magnetic Field Distribution

Another advantage is the consistent magnetic field distribution of cylindrical magnets. The shape of the cylinder allows for a more uniform magnetic field around its axis. This is essential in many electronic applications where a stable and predictable magnetic field is required.

In electric motors, for example, a consistent magnetic field ensures smooth and efficient operation. Cylindrical magnets can be used as the rotor magnets in small electric motors found in drones or other consumer electronics. The uniform magnetic field helps in reducing vibrations and noise, while also improving the overall performance and lifespan of the motor. 4. Cost - Effectiveness

Cylindrical magnets are often more cost - effective compared to other magnet shapes. The manufacturing process for cylindrical magnets is relatively straightforward, which can lead to lower production costs. This cost advantage can be passed on to the manufacturers of electronic devices, making them a more attractive option for large - scale production.

For mass - produced consumer electronics like earbuds or wireless chargers, cost is a major factor. Using cylindrical magnets can help keep the production costs down without sacrificing performance. This allows manufacturers to offer more affordable products to consumers while still maintaining a high level of quality.

5. Easy to Assemble

Assembly is a critical step in the manufacturing of electronic devices. Cylindrical magnets are very easy to handle and assemble. Their shape makes them easy to pick up, place, and secure in the device.

In automated assembly lines, cylindrical magnets can be quickly and accurately placed using robotic arms. This reduces the assembly time and labor costs, increasing the overall efficiency of the manufacturing process. Whether it's inserting a cylindrical magnet into a sensor or attaching it to a circuit board, the simplicity of assembly makes them a preferred choice for many electronics manufacturers.

6. Durability

Cylindrical magnets are generally quite durable. They can withstand mechanical stress, temperature variations, and other environmental factors. This durability is important in electronic devices that are expected to have a long lifespan.

For example, in automotive electronics, where the devices are exposed to harsh conditions such as high temperatures, vibrations, and moisture, cylindrical magnets can maintain their magnetic properties over time. This ensures the reliable operation of components like sensors and actuators in the vehicle.

8. Energy Efficiency

In many electronic applications, energy efficiency is a top priority. Cylindrical magnets can contribute to energy savings. In electric motors, as mentioned earlier, their consistent magnetic field allows for more efficient conversion of electrical energy into mechanical energy.

In power generators, cylindrical magnets can be used to generate electricity more efficiently. Their strong magnetic field can induce a higher voltage in the coils, resulting in increased power output with less input energy. This is beneficial for both consumer electronics and industrial applications, as it helps in reducing energy consumption and costs.
